#a59660 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a59660 is composed of 64.7% red, 58.8%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.1% magenta, 41.8%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 47 degrees, a saturation of 27.7% and a lightness of 51.2%. #a59660 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c0 with #4b2d00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#a59660 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a59660 has RGB values of R:165, G:150,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.42,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10851936.

Shades and Tints of #a59660
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040302 is the darkest color, while #faf9f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a59660
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#88867d is the less saturated color, while #fbc70a is the most saturated one.
